Please in Thai and French

When you want to request someone for something then it is necessary to say please. But if you don't know how to say please in Thai and French then it disappointing. So, Thai Greetings vs French greetings helps us to learn please in Thai and French language.

  • Please in Thai : โปรด (Pord).
  • Please in French : S'il vous plaît.

In some situations, if you need to apologize then Thai greetings vs French greetings provides to say sorry in Thai and French language.

  • Sorry in Thai : ขอโทษ (K̄hxthos̄ʹ).
  • Sorry in French : désolé.

How are you in Thai and French

After you say hello to someone then you will want to ask how are you? And if you wish to know what's how are you in Thai and French then Thai greetings vs French greetings helps you.

  • How are you in Thai is คุณเป็นอย่างไร? (Khuṇ pĕn xỳāngrị?).
  • How are you in French is Comment allez-vous?.

Other Thai and French Greetings

Are you finding few more Thai greetings vs French greetings? So let's compare other Thai and French greetings.

  • Good Morning in Thai is อรุณสวัสดิ์ (Xruṇ s̄wạs̄di̒).
  • Good Night in Thai is นอนหลับฝันดี (Nxn h̄lạb f̄ạn dī).
  • Good Morning in French is Bonjour.
  • Good Night in French is bonne Nuit.
